[CYGWIN] GTK sous cygwin

GTK sous cygwin [CYGWIN] - Installation - Linux et OS Alternatifs

Marsh Posté le 23-01-2003 à 19:42:41    

Salut,
 
je voudrais savoir si quelqu un a deja reussi a compilé glib/gtk sous cygwin ET a le faire marcher, parce que la je commence vraiment a déseperer ....
 
 :hello:


---------------
WoIP - Video and Voice over IP -  http://www.woip.net/
Reply

Marsh Posté le 23-01-2003 à 19:42:41   

Reply

Marsh Posté le 23-01-2003 à 20:17:30    

Ca m'interresse aussi

Reply

Marsh Posté le 23-01-2003 à 20:18:34    

mean a écrit :

Ca m'interresse aussi


 
t as deja essayé ou pas ?


---------------
WoIP - Video and Voice over IP -  http://www.woip.net/
Reply

Marsh Posté le 23-01-2003 à 20:19:38    

J'ai essayé avec les binaires mais sans succes

Reply

Marsh Posté le 23-01-2003 à 21:43:22    

si tu veux faire fonctionner glib/gtk sous Windows, il ne faut pas utiliser cygwin  
le principe de cygwin c'est l'utilisation d'une dll pour simuler un systeme unix sous windows (donc y'a gcc + pleins d'autres outils qui ont ete recompiles)  
 
glib et gtk on ete porte nativement sous windows.  
 
donc il faut utiliser mingw (comme cygwin c'est base sur gcc, mais ce coup si c'est du natif windows sans passer par une dll)  
ou alors cette merde infame de Visual C (quoique pour du C pur ca doit pas gener beaucoup)  
http://www.mingw.org/
 
http://www.gimp.org/~tml/gimp/win32/  
 
"In order to use the DLLs as distributed in programs you build  
yourself, you must use either gcc-2.95.2 (or later, 2.95.3 certainly  
works, dunno about GCC 3), or Microsoft Visual C++ 5 or 6"  
 
j'ai fait fonctionner gtk y'a 2 ans avec Visual et y'a 6 mois avec mingw en cross-compilation. Mais faut pas me demander comment, j'en sais plus rien.  
 
je me souviens avoir vu passer quelques posts sur programmation a ce sujet et une des personnes avait reussi a programmer sous windows avec.


Message édité par tanguy le 23-01-2003 à 21:45:21
Reply

Marsh Posté le 23-01-2003 à 21:55:07    

tanguy a écrit :

si tu veux faire fonctionner glib/gtk sous Windows, il ne faut pas utiliser cygwin
 
le principe de cygwin c'est l'utilisation d'une dll pour simuler un systeme unix sous windows (donc y'a gcc + pleins d'autres outils qui ont ete recompiles)
 
 
 
glib et gtk on ete porte nativement sous windows.
 
 
 
donc il faut utiliser mingw (comme cygwin c'est base sur gcc, mais ce coup si c'est du natif windows sans passer par une dll)
 
ou alors cette merde infame de Visual C (quoique pour du C pur ca doit pas gener beaucoup)
 
http://www.mingw.org/
 
 
http://www.gimp.org/~tml/gimp/win32/
 
 
 
"In order to use the DLLs as distributed in programs you build
 
yourself, you must use either gcc-2.95.2 (or later, 2.95.3 certainly
 
works, dunno about GCC 3), or Microsoft Visual C++ 5 or 6"
 
 
 
j'ai fait fonctionner gtk y'a 2 ans avec Visual et y'a 6 mois avec mingw en cross-compilation. Mais faut pas me demander comment, j'en sais plus rien.
 
 
 
je me souviens avoir vu passer quelques posts sur programmation a ce sujet et une des personnes avait reussi a programmer sous windows avec.


 
ouais j ai deja fais marcher du gtk sous windows mais le code qui va avec est vraiment incompilable sous Visual c bien ca mon probleme ....


---------------
WoIP - Video and Voice over IP -  http://www.woip.net/
Reply

Marsh Posté le 23-01-2003 à 22:14:01    

MrTonio a écrit :

 
le code qui va avec est vraiment incompilable sous Visual c


 
en C++ ? ou alors tu utilises des libs unix genre les sockets, les signaux, les threads... ?
 
probablement que mingw sera la solution

Reply

Marsh Posté le 23-01-2003 à 22:19:19    

tanguy a écrit :


 
en C++ ? ou alors tu utilises des libs unix genre les sockets, les signaux, les threads... ?
 
probablement que mingw sera la solution


 
ouais j utilise des sockets ...... et ca windows il connait po de la meme facon k unix !
mais si ca marche avec mingw, c cool ;)


---------------
WoIP - Video and Voice over IP -  http://www.woip.net/
Reply

Marsh Posté le 24-01-2003 à 01:27:44    

MrTonio a écrit :

 
si ca marche avec mingw, c cool  

 
 
je pense pas que ca fonctionnera directement. mingw c'est gcc porte en natif pour windows, donc sans rien autour: juste le compilo.  
 
Il doit bien y avoir quelqu'un qui a pondu les sockets unix pour windows.  
il faut deja essayer et si ca fonctionne pas, regarder sur la mailing list de mingw et faire du google.  
 
sinon tu peux regarder ca :  
http://gaim.sourceforge.net/  
 
un trillian like (donc ca utilise les sockets) en gtk qui fonctionne sous linux et sous windows a mingw
 
remarque ils ont peut etre tout simplement (sic) fait une couche d'abstraction aux sockets et utiliser les winsocks sous windows.


Message édité par tanguy le 24-01-2003 à 01:30:25
Reply

Marsh Posté le 25-01-2003 à 13:38:54    

:bounce:


---------------
WoIP - Video and Voice over IP -  http://www.woip.net/
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ed